Calculates confidence interval

The boldness interval of proportion calculator employs statistical formulation to compute the boldness interval for the inhabitants proportion based mostly on the pattern knowledge.

One generally used methodology for calculating the boldness interval is the traditional distribution-based method. This methodology assumes that the pattern proportion follows a standard distribution, which is a bell-shaped curve. The formulation for the boldness interval utilizing the traditional distribution is:

Confidence Interval = Pattern Proportion ± Margin of Error

The margin of error is calculated as:

Margin of Error = Z * √((Pattern Proportion * (1 – Pattern Proportion)) / Pattern Measurement)

the place:

  • Z is the z-score equivalent to the specified confidence degree
  • Pattern Proportion is the proportion of successes within the pattern
  • Pattern Measurement is the entire variety of observations within the pattern

By plugging within the values for the pattern proportion, pattern measurement, and the specified confidence degree, the calculator determines the margin of error and subsequently the boldness interval.

The ensuing confidence interval represents the vary of values inside which the true inhabitants proportion is prone to fall with the required confidence degree.

It is necessary to notice that the boldness interval is a statistical estimation, and there’s a sure chance that the true inhabitants proportion lies exterior the interval. Nonetheless, by deciding on an acceptable confidence degree, we will improve the chance that the interval accommodates the true inhabitants proportion.

Assumes regular distribution

The boldness interval of proportion calculator assumes that the pattern proportion follows a standard distribution. This assumption is commonly affordable when the pattern measurement is giant sufficient (sometimes at the least 30 successes and 30 failures). The conventional distribution is a bell-shaped curve that’s symmetric across the imply.

The idea of normality permits us to make use of statistical formulation and tables to calculate the boldness interval. These formulation and tables are based mostly on the properties of the traditional distribution.

If the pattern measurement is small (lower than 30 successes and 30 failures), the belief of normality is probably not acceptable. In such instances, various strategies, comparable to the precise binomial confidence interval, could also be extra appropriate.

It is necessary to notice that the normality assumption is a statistical assumption, and it might not at all times maintain true in follow. Nonetheless, when the pattern measurement is giant sufficient, the central restrict theorem ensures that the pattern proportion will roughly observe a standard distribution, even when the inhabitants distribution is non-normal.

By assuming normality, the boldness interval calculator can present a dependable estimate of the inhabitants proportion and the related confidence interval, permitting researchers and analysts to make knowledgeable inferences in regards to the traits of the bigger inhabitants.
